Grant Opportunity: DoD Autism Idea Development Award

A funding opportunity for those in the health sciences or education. From the solicitation, the FY16 ARP Idea Development Award seeks applications from all areas of basic and preclinical research and strongly encourages applications that address the critical needs of the autism spectrum disorder (ASD) community in areas that include "[f]actors promoting success in key transitions to independence for individuals living with ASD."

FUNDING OPPORTUNITY:
DoD Autism Idea Development Award

FON:
W81XWH-16-ARP-IDA

AGENCY:
Army (Army), Department of Defense (Defense) , Congressionally Directed Medical Research Programs

ITEM:
Notice announcing the development of innovative, high-risk/high-reward research that could lead to critical discoveries or major advancements that will accelerate progress in improving outcomes for individuals with ASD. This award mechanism is designed to support innovative ideas with the potential to yield impactful data and new avenues of investigation.​

ACTION:

​Pre-applications are due June 22, 2016. Invited applications are due September 29, 2016. Approximately $3.6 million is available for six awards.
